Who is legally responsible for overseeing the activities of real estate agents within a brokerage?✔✔The managing or sponsoring broker
What must be in place before an agent can legally conduct brokerage activity?✔✔A written sponsorship with a licensed broker
What is a fiduciary duty owed by a broker to a client?✔✔Loyalty
What is meant by the term "procuring cause"?✔✔The actions of a broker or agent that directly lead to a completed sale
What document outlines the relationship and responsibilities between a broker and a sales agent?✔✔Independent Contractor Agreement

What must a brokerage do to comply with recordkeeping requirements?✔✔Retain transaction records for a specified period based on state law
What type of insurance is often carried by brokerages to protect against liability claims?✔✔Errors and Omissions (E&O) Insurance
What is required for a broker to advertise a property on behalf of a seller?✔✔A signed listing agreement
What does it mean when a broker acts as a "dual agent" in a transaction?✔✔The broker represents both the buyer and the seller in the same transaction
What must a broker do before disclosing confidential information about a client?✔✔Obtain the client’s written permission
What is typically included in a brokerage’s policy and procedures manual?✔✔Standards for advertising, client interaction, disclosures, and ethical conduct

What is the purpose of a buyer representation agreement?✔✔To create an agency relationship between the buyer and the broker
When is a broker entitled to receive a commission?✔✔When the broker produces a ready, willing, and able buyer under the terms of the contract
What should a broker do if a dispute arises between agents over commission?✔✔Refer to the brokerage policy and attempt internal mediation
What is a net listing?✔✔An agreement where the broker receives any sale amount over a set net price desired by the seller
What should a brokerage have in place to prevent fair housing violations?✔✔Written anti-discrimination policies and training for all agents

What is the legal requirement for advertising real estate services online?✔✔All ads must include the broker’s name and comply with state regulations
Why is supervision of agents critical in a real estate brokerage?✔✔To ensure legal compliance, protect consumers, and reduce liability
What is a desk fee in a brokerage?✔✔A fee paid by agents to the broker in exchange for office space and resources
What does it mean for an agent to "hang their license" with a broker?✔✔To be sponsored by that broker and operate under their supervision
When must earnest money be deposited according to brokerage policy?✔✔Within the time frame required by law or the contract, typically within a few business days
How can a brokerage limit liability for agent misconduct?✔✔Provide training, supervision, and enforce compliance with laws and ethics
